WebSep 2, 2015 · 3) Facilitated diffusion is a type of passive transport in which ions/molecules cross the semi permeable membrane because permeases present in the membrane facilitate the transport. Like simple diffusion facilitated diffusion doesn't require metabolic energy and simply occurs across the concentration gradient. WebNov 8, 2024 · Facilitated diffusion requires no energy input, in contrast to active transport processes (solute transport against the concentration gradient) that require an external source energy [2]. WebIn addition, this type of transport, like simple diffusion, does not require an input of energy. Facilitated diffusion can occur in two different ways, through channel proteins and carrier proteins. Channel proteins resemble fluid filled tubes through which the solutes can move down their concentration gradients across the membrane.
